SlideShare ist ein Scribd-Unternehmen logo
1 von 22
Nuestra experiencia con el proyecto GxUnit Enrique Almeida   [email_address] Alejandro Araújo   [email_address] Uruguay Larre Borges  [email_address]
Agenda ,[object Object],[object Object],[object Object],[object Object]
¿Por qué GxUnit? ,[object Object],[object Object]
¿Por qué GxUnit? Evolución  2003 2004 2005 2006 2007 2008 Proyecto Colaborativo   Proyecto Ingeniería  de Software UDELAR Idea XIV Encuentro Internacional GeneXus Testeo Unitario en GeneXus
¿Por qué GxUnit? Características ,[object Object],[object Object],[object Object],[object Object]
Agenda ,[object Object],[object Object],[object Object],[object Object]
¿Para qué GxUnit? ,[object Object],[object Object]
¿Para qué GxUnit? Integración temprana de las actividades de prueba al ciclo de vida. El esfuerzo de corregir errores crece a medida que avanzamos en él: (Extraído de curso Ing.de Software, Fac.Ing., Udelar)
¿Para qué GxUnit? “… las fallas más notorias en la historia del desarrollo del software fueron todas debidas a defectos en las unidades, defectos que podrían haber sido encontrados aplicando las pruebas unitarias apropiadas. ”   (Boris Beizer)
¿Para qué GxUnit? Automatización 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
Agenda ,[object Object],[object Object],[object Object],[object Object]
¿Qué tenemos? 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object]
¿Qué tenemos? Casos de Prueba
¿Qué tenemos? Casos de Prueba
¿Qué tenemos? Reporte
¿Qué tenemos? Bitácora
¿Qué tenemos? GxUnit en Acción ,[object Object]
Agenda ,[object Object],[object Object],[object Object],[object Object]
¿Qué nos falta? ,[object Object],[object Object],[object Object],[object Object]
¿Qué nos falta? Nuevo alcance ,[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],GxUnit
[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],[object Object],Nuestra experiencia con el proyecto GxUnit
[object Object],[object Object],Créditos (Grupos 1 y 2): Adrián García Antonio Malaquina Anthony Figueroa Diego Gawenda Darío de León Guillermo Polito Federico Parins Fernando Varesi Cecilia Apa Ken Tenzer Horacio López Ignacio Esmite Diego San Esteban Fernando Colman Gervasio Marchand Guillermo Pérez Lucía Adinolfi Marcelo Falcón Marcelo Celio Marcelo Vignolo Martín Sellanes Nicolás Alvarez de Ron Rafel Sisto Rodrigo Aguerre Rodrigo Ordeix  Rosana Robaina Soledad Pérez Stephanie de León Enrique Almeida  [email_address] Alejandro Araújo  [email_address] Uruguay Larre Borges  [email_address] Nuestra experiencia con  el proyecto GxUnit

Weitere ähnliche Inhalte

Andere mochten auch

Secuencia didáctica integrada
Secuencia didáctica integradaSecuencia didáctica integrada
Secuencia didáctica integrada
Aida March
 
Las artes pláticas como mediación fundamental del pensamiento creativo en los...
Las artes pláticas como mediación fundamental del pensamiento creativo en los...Las artes pláticas como mediación fundamental del pensamiento creativo en los...
Las artes pláticas como mediación fundamental del pensamiento creativo en los...
andavipe
 
VIH SIDA y Respuesta inmune del huesped
VIH SIDA y Respuesta inmune del huespedVIH SIDA y Respuesta inmune del huesped
VIH SIDA y Respuesta inmune del huesped
Neko
 
Investigación acción
Investigación   acciónInvestigación   acción
Investigación acción
andavipe
 
Modelo educativo
Modelo educativoModelo educativo
Modelo educativo
papos
 
Secuencia didáctica integrada
Secuencia didáctica integradaSecuencia didáctica integrada
Secuencia didáctica integrada
Aida March
 
Web 2.0 y bibliotecas públicas: de la experimentación a la evaluación
Web 2.0 y bibliotecas públicas: de la experimentación a la evaluaciónWeb 2.0 y bibliotecas públicas: de la experimentación a la evaluación
Web 2.0 y bibliotecas públicas: de la experimentación a la evaluación
Torres Salinas
 

Andere mochten auch (20)

Secuencia didáctica integrada
Secuencia didáctica integradaSecuencia didáctica integrada
Secuencia didáctica integrada
 
Publicidad y emarketing
Publicidad y emarketingPublicidad y emarketing
Publicidad y emarketing
 
Guía orientativa dirigida a pymes sobre la transposición de la directiva marc...
Guía orientativa dirigida a pymes sobre la transposición de la directiva marc...Guía orientativa dirigida a pymes sobre la transposición de la directiva marc...
Guía orientativa dirigida a pymes sobre la transposición de la directiva marc...
 
Las artes pláticas como mediación fundamental del pensamiento creativo en los...
Las artes pláticas como mediación fundamental del pensamiento creativo en los...Las artes pláticas como mediación fundamental del pensamiento creativo en los...
Las artes pláticas como mediación fundamental del pensamiento creativo en los...
 
VIH SIDA y Respuesta inmune del huesped
VIH SIDA y Respuesta inmune del huespedVIH SIDA y Respuesta inmune del huesped
VIH SIDA y Respuesta inmune del huesped
 
Investigación acción
Investigación   acciónInvestigación   acción
Investigación acción
 
La ciència que s'amaga pels racons
La ciència que s'amaga pels raconsLa ciència que s'amaga pels racons
La ciència que s'amaga pels racons
 
Redes locales 4
Redes locales 4Redes locales 4
Redes locales 4
 
Modelo educativo
Modelo educativoModelo educativo
Modelo educativo
 
Sexting
SextingSexting
Sexting
 
Sintesis lineamientos
Sintesis lineamientosSintesis lineamientos
Sintesis lineamientos
 
Secuencia didáctica integrada
Secuencia didáctica integradaSecuencia didáctica integrada
Secuencia didáctica integrada
 
E learning empresarial
E learning empresarialE learning empresarial
E learning empresarial
 
Introducción a las Redes Sociales
Introducción a las Redes SocialesIntroducción a las Redes Sociales
Introducción a las Redes Sociales
 
Catálogo de Rutas y Visitas Culturales 2010
Catálogo de Rutas y Visitas Culturales 2010Catálogo de Rutas y Visitas Culturales 2010
Catálogo de Rutas y Visitas Culturales 2010
 
Servicios públicos domiciliarios
Servicios públicos domiciliariosServicios públicos domiciliarios
Servicios públicos domiciliarios
 
Clase 3. Apuntes.
Clase 3. Apuntes.Clase 3. Apuntes.
Clase 3. Apuntes.
 
Como Construir Negocios Exitosos en Internet - Ricardo Zegarra
Como Construir Negocios Exitosos en Internet - Ricardo ZegarraComo Construir Negocios Exitosos en Internet - Ricardo Zegarra
Como Construir Negocios Exitosos en Internet - Ricardo Zegarra
 
Web 2.0 y bibliotecas públicas: de la experimentación a la evaluación
Web 2.0 y bibliotecas públicas: de la experimentación a la evaluaciónWeb 2.0 y bibliotecas públicas: de la experimentación a la evaluación
Web 2.0 y bibliotecas públicas: de la experimentación a la evaluación
 
Herramientas de foros de voz
Herramientas de foros de vozHerramientas de foros de voz
Herramientas de foros de voz
 

Ähnlich wie Our Experience with the GxUnit Project (Almeida, LarreBorges, Araújo)

ELEMENTOS DE LA CONFIGURACION DE SOFTWARE.ppt
ELEMENTOS DE LA CONFIGURACION DE SOFTWARE.pptELEMENTOS DE LA CONFIGURACION DE SOFTWARE.ppt
ELEMENTOS DE LA CONFIGURACION DE SOFTWARE.ppt
Marko Zapata
 
Encuentro GeneXus 2006 Collaborative Projects
Encuentro GeneXus 2006 Collaborative ProjectsEncuentro GeneXus 2006 Collaborative Projects
Encuentro GeneXus 2006 Collaborative Projects
Enrique Almeida
 
Trabajo diapositiva modulo 3 de josue
Trabajo diapositiva modulo 3 de josueTrabajo diapositiva modulo 3 de josue
Trabajo diapositiva modulo 3 de josue
Josue Zelaya
 

Ähnlich wie Our Experience with the GxUnit Project (Almeida, LarreBorges, Araújo) (20)

GxUnit-En sus comienzos...(Almeida, LarreBorges, Araújo)
GxUnit-En sus comienzos...(Almeida, LarreBorges, Araújo)GxUnit-En sus comienzos...(Almeida, LarreBorges, Araújo)
GxUnit-En sus comienzos...(Almeida, LarreBorges, Araújo)
 
¿Cómo poner software de calidad en manos del usuario de forma rápida?
¿Cómo poner software de calidad en manos del usuario de forma rápida?¿Cómo poner software de calidad en manos del usuario de forma rápida?
¿Cómo poner software de calidad en manos del usuario de forma rápida?
 
Encuentrogx2006collaborativeprojects 090910122800-phpapp01
Encuentrogx2006collaborativeprojects 090910122800-phpapp01Encuentrogx2006collaborativeprojects 090910122800-phpapp01
Encuentrogx2006collaborativeprojects 090910122800-phpapp01
 
Esquemas de pruebas
Esquemas de pruebasEsquemas de pruebas
Esquemas de pruebas
 
Proyecto GxUnit - Congreso Cacic2008 (Almeida, LarreBorges, Araújo)
Proyecto GxUnit - Congreso Cacic2008 (Almeida, LarreBorges, Araújo)Proyecto GxUnit - Congreso Cacic2008 (Almeida, LarreBorges, Araújo)
Proyecto GxUnit - Congreso Cacic2008 (Almeida, LarreBorges, Araújo)
 
GESTION DE PROYECTOS INFORMATICOS
GESTION  DE PROYECTOS INFORMATICOSGESTION  DE PROYECTOS INFORMATICOS
GESTION DE PROYECTOS INFORMATICOS
 
ELEMENTOS DE LA CONFIGURACION DE SOFTWARE.ppt
ELEMENTOS DE LA CONFIGURACION DE SOFTWARE.pptELEMENTOS DE LA CONFIGURACION DE SOFTWARE.ppt
ELEMENTOS DE LA CONFIGURACION DE SOFTWARE.ppt
 
Encuentro GeneXus 2006 Collaborative Projects
Encuentro GeneXus 2006 Collaborative ProjectsEncuentro GeneXus 2006 Collaborative Projects
Encuentro GeneXus 2006 Collaborative Projects
 
Es diseño y elaboración miller rodríguez
Es diseño y elaboración miller rodríguezEs diseño y elaboración miller rodríguez
Es diseño y elaboración miller rodríguez
 
Construyendo una herramienta para pruebas unitarias en GeneXus
Construyendo una herramienta para pruebas unitarias en GeneXusConstruyendo una herramienta para pruebas unitarias en GeneXus
Construyendo una herramienta para pruebas unitarias en GeneXus
 
Trabajo diapositiva modulo 3 de josue
Trabajo diapositiva modulo 3 de josueTrabajo diapositiva modulo 3 de josue
Trabajo diapositiva modulo 3 de josue
 
Ci4 free
Ci4 freeCi4 free
Ci4 free
 
GeneXus
GeneXusGeneXus
GeneXus
 
Calidad de software
Calidad de softwareCalidad de software
Calidad de software
 
Trabajo diapositiva Software por Jhonatan Ruiz
Trabajo diapositiva  Software por Jhonatan RuizTrabajo diapositiva  Software por Jhonatan Ruiz
Trabajo diapositiva Software por Jhonatan Ruiz
 
Trabajo diapositiva modulo 3 de jhonatan
Trabajo diapositiva modulo 3 de jhonatanTrabajo diapositiva modulo 3 de jhonatan
Trabajo diapositiva modulo 3 de jhonatan
 
Meetup: Mobile Automation
Meetup: Mobile AutomationMeetup: Mobile Automation
Meetup: Mobile Automation
 
GxUnit - GeneXus Unit Testing
GxUnit - GeneXus Unit TestingGxUnit - GeneXus Unit Testing
GxUnit - GeneXus Unit Testing
 
CoSECiVi 2020 - Development of a User-Friendly Application for Creating Tacti...
CoSECiVi 2020 - Development of a User-Friendly Application for Creating Tacti...CoSECiVi 2020 - Development of a User-Friendly Application for Creating Tacti...
CoSECiVi 2020 - Development of a User-Friendly Application for Creating Tacti...
 
Proceso desarrollo software
Proceso desarrollo softwareProceso desarrollo software
Proceso desarrollo software
 

Mehr von Alejandro Araújo

Mehr von Alejandro Araújo (7)

Test Driven Development. Fortalezas y Debilidades
Test Driven Development. Fortalezas y DebilidadesTest Driven Development. Fortalezas y Debilidades
Test Driven Development. Fortalezas y Debilidades
 
Investigación sobre Dublin Core Data Model (Camargo-Araújo)
Investigación sobre Dublin Core Data Model (Camargo-Araújo)Investigación sobre Dublin Core Data Model (Camargo-Araújo)
Investigación sobre Dublin Core Data Model (Camargo-Araújo)
 
GXFIT-Especificación de marco de pruebas
GXFIT-Especificación de marco de pruebasGXFIT-Especificación de marco de pruebas
GXFIT-Especificación de marco de pruebas
 
Propuesta mejora proceso desarrollo Software (2002) (Diaz Arnesto, Araújo) ...
Propuesta mejora proceso desarrollo Software (2002) (Diaz Arnesto, Araújo)   ...Propuesta mejora proceso desarrollo Software (2002) (Diaz Arnesto, Araújo)   ...
Propuesta mejora proceso desarrollo Software (2002) (Diaz Arnesto, Araújo) ...
 
Metologías Ágiles ¿Testing Ágil? (LarreBorges, Schreiber, Araújo)
Metologías Ágiles ¿Testing Ágil?  (LarreBorges, Schreiber, Araújo)Metologías Ágiles ¿Testing Ágil?  (LarreBorges, Schreiber, Araújo)
Metologías Ágiles ¿Testing Ágil? (LarreBorges, Schreiber, Araújo)
 
Especificación GxFIT - Defensa Tesis Maestría
Especificación GxFIT - Defensa Tesis MaestríaEspecificación GxFIT - Defensa Tesis Maestría
Especificación GxFIT - Defensa Tesis Maestría
 
Presentación Fitnesse
Presentación Fitnesse Presentación Fitnesse
Presentación Fitnesse
 

Kürzlich hochgeladen

EP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ial UninoveEP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ial Uninove
FagnerLisboa3
 
Modul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dfModul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df
AnnimoUno1
 

Kürzlich hochgeladen (11)

EP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ial UninoveEPA-pdf resultado da prova presencial Uninove
EPA-pdf resultado da prova presencial Uninove
 
PROYECTO FINAL. Tutorial para publicar en SlideShare.pptx
PROYECTO FINAL. Tutorial para publicar en SlideShare.pptxPROYECTO FINAL. Tutorial para publicar en SlideShare.pptx
PROYECTO FINAL. Tutorial para publicar en SlideShare.pptx
 
pruebas unitarias unitarias en java con JUNIT
pruebas unitarias unitarias en java con JUNITpruebas unitarias unitarias en java con JUNIT
pruebas unitarias unitarias en java con JUNIT
 
Innovaciones tecnologicas en el siglo 21
Innovaciones tecnologicas en el siglo 21Innovaciones tecnologicas en el siglo 21
Innovaciones tecnologicas en el siglo 21
 
Refr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df
Refr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dfRefr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df
Refrigerador_Inverter_Samsung_Curso_y_Manual_de_Servicio_Español.pdf
 
Avances tecnológicos del siglo XXI 10-07 eyvana
Avances tecnológicos del siglo XXI 10-07 eyvanaAvances tecnológicos del siglo XXI 10-07 eyvana
Avances tecnológicos del siglo XXI 10-07 eyvana
 
EL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ptx
EL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ptxEL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ptx
EL CICLO PRÁCTICO DE UN MOTOR DE CUATRO TIEMPOS.pptx
 
Avances tecnológicos del siglo XXI y ejemplos de estos
Avances tecnológicos del siglo XXI y ejemplos de estosAvances tecnológicos del siglo XXI y ejemplos de estos
Avances tecnológicos del siglo XXI y ejemplos de estos
 
Modul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dfModulo-Mini Cargador.................pdf
Modulo-Mini Cargador.................pdf
 
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...
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...
Resistencia extrema al cobre por un consorcio bacteriano conformado por Sulfo...
 
How to use Redis with MuleSoft. A quick start presentation.
How to use Redis with MuleSoft. A quick start presentation.How to use Redis with MuleSoft. A quick start presentation.
How to use Redis with MuleSoft. A quick start presentation.
 

Our Experience with the GxUnit Project (Almeida, LarreBorges, Araújo)

  • 1. Nuestra experiencia con el proyecto GxUnit Enrique Almeida [email_address] Alejandro Araújo [email_address] Uruguay Larre Borges [email_address]
  • 2.
  • 3.
  • 4. ¿Por qué GxUnit? Evolución 2003 2004 2005 2006 2007 2008 Proyecto Colaborativo Proyecto Ingeniería de Software UDELAR Idea XIV Encuentro Internacional GeneXus Testeo Unitario en GeneXus
  • 5.
  • 6.
  • 7.
  • 8. ¿Para qué GxUnit? Integración temprana de las actividades de prueba al ciclo de vida. El esfuerzo de corregir errores crece a medida que avanzamos en él: (Extraído de curso Ing.de Software, Fac.Ing., Udelar)
  • 9. ¿Para qué GxUnit? “… las fallas más notorias en la historia del desarrollo del software fueron todas debidas a defectos en las unidades, defectos que podrían haber sido encontrados aplicando las pruebas unitarias apropiadas. ” (Boris Beizer)
  • 10.
  • 11.
  • 12.
  • 17.
  • 18.
  • 19.
  • 20.
  • 21.
  • 22.